  • TotalBF2 Upgrading to vBulletin 3.6

    TotalBF2.com is in preparation for a massive upgrade to vBulletin v3.6. This has many great new features for Administrators/Moderators and the End-User., you can see many of the new features in this thread.

    The main reason why I am posting this is there is possibility and already has happened a few times of noticeable server slow downs and even possible server outages during the early morning hours (2am-6am EST) due to the sheer size of the current database. We are working to keep this to a minimum while we prep and test the current site with the new version of vBulletin.

    Sorry for any inconveniences this may cause.

    Note: We hope to have the update done by the end of the week/start of next week.
